Vickie J. Jasinski, age 63, formerly of Palmyra, died on Friday, September 20, 2013 a resident of the Orangeville Nursing and Rehabilitation Center in Orangeville, Pennsylvania. Vickie lived most of her life in the Palmyra area.
Vickie was born on Sunday, October 9, 1949 in Carlisle, Pennsylvania, a daughter of the late Peter and Doris (Romberger) Harvey. Vickie completed her education after graduating from the Hershey High School. Vickie spent her life caring for her family in the home.
On November 30, 1999, Vickie was preceded in death by her late husband, Robert Jasinski. She was also preceded by a son, Scott Sweigart in 2007 and also by a brother, Steve Harvey.
Survivors include two daughters: Connie Kline and husband, Herb, of Bloomsburg; and Robin Jasinski of Harrisburg; a son Sean Sweigart; seven grandchildren, two great-grandchildren, a step-son: Mark Ericson and wife, Wendy, of Georgia; a daughter-in-law: Joanna Sweigart of Middletown; a sister Karen Hopple and husband, John, of Palmyra; and a brother: Kevin Filippelli and spouse, Jamie, of Las Vegas, NV.
Vickie will be laid to rest in the Indiantown Gap National Cemetery in Annville. The Jasinski family is being assisted by the Allen Funeral Home, 745 Market at Eighth Street, Bloomsburg.
